Red cabbage
Red Cabbage (also known as Purple Cabbage or Red Kraut) has leaves that are colored dark red/purple but turn blue once cooked. Holding a flavor that is strong than that of Savoy Cabbages, it is often used raw for salads & coleslaw, and makes for the perfect side dish to almost any meal!Seasonal all-year round but best from November till December.
